About to start a new save with Liverpool and wanting to buy a CB.
I know normally people go for Éder Álvarez Balanta but I'm looking for someone different.

Here are my requirements:
Nationality: English
Age:​ ​Below 28
Budget:
15,000,000 pounds (asking price)

I was thinking Steven caulker but hasn't he just moved clubs so won't be possible to buy?
 
Are there any other good english players for defense? need to up my home grown quota haha
 
I would suggest John Stones from Everton, but as your Liverpool this could be difficult. Harry Maguire gets pretty good, but don't think he's strong enough to slot straight in. Gary Cahill and Steven Caulker maybe, although the latter has a few obvious weaknesses.

Phil Jones is another suggestion, not as good on this as in previous games but once again as you're Liverpool buying from United is going to inflate prices.

That's a good point I hadn't thought of that. English CBs are pretty thin on the ground unfortunately and you being Liverpool does sadly limit your options. I know you don't want Balanta, but he is a cracker of a player.
 
Ryan Shawcross? Dunno what his value would be, though..
 
Caulker is a solid english CB. Stones can be a great one but he was expensive for me, cost 25m+ pounds.
Phil Jones is class but as Liverpool, there's no way Man U will want to sell to you for a reasonable price.
 
Caulker will move again. Chelsea just paid £10mil for him on mine.
 
Liam Moore is a really good shout he always seems to turn out good.

Reece Oxford from West Ham he looks beastly!! can sign him for under £1m
 
Kyle Bartley, do not listen to your assistant, buy him and play him. He will be a very trusty and solid center back. He cost only 1M Euro, but believe me, you will not be disappointed. Train him quickness first. In two-three months he have 14 both acceleration and pace.
 
Anyone tried Harry Maguire?

I bought him second season to play backup in my spurs team. He is a consistent player and chips in with a few headed goals! I'd reccomend him; even though your Assistant manager my not agree!
